Calcium and Bone Mineral Supplement for Horses Grazing Oxalate-containing Pastures

Cal-XTRA is formulated as a critical supplement for horses grazing in regions with oxalate-containing grasses, commonly in Queensland, The Northern Territory and parts of New South Wales and Victoria.

Tropical and sub-tropical grass, particularly setaria, para, buffel, teff, pangola, kikuya, couch grass and green panic, contain oxalates which bind up and reduce the absorption of calcium, resulting in calcium deficiency which can lead to bone weakness.

Cal-XTRA is a concentrated source of bone minerals, especially calcium, to ensure extra supply and help prevent bone demineralisation that would otherwise lead to lameness, osteoporosis and Big Head.

Horses on high grain diets also benefit from the calcium and other nutrients supplied by Cal-XTRA to help bone strength and soundness during moderate to intense training.

The Concept of Cal-Xtra:

Kohnke’s Own Cal-XTRA is the result of more than 12 years of research and field trials by equine veterinarian and horse nutrition authority Dr John Kohnke, especially in the areas where horses are known to have poor calcium uptake and Big Head.

Cal-XTRA is highly concentrated and contains more palatable forms of calcium compared to ‘chelated’ calcium supplements, making it a superior and more economical choice.

It is scientifically formulated to protect calcium absorption in the presence of oxalates through a stable coating technology which shields calcium from oxalate binding with a specialised micro-coating process. This allows optimum calcium uptake to ensure bone strength and soundness, even when horses are grazing tropical grass pastures.

Which Horses Benefit?

Cal-XTRA provides high strength additional calcium and important bone minerals in cases where extra is needed, for example, during bone regeneration, or when rapidly growing tropical grasses are the dominant pasture type available to the horse.

*Horses in QLD and NT, where tropical and subtropical grasses such as setaria, para, buffel, pangola, kikuya, couch grass and green panic are at high levels in the pastures
*Horses in parts of NSW and VIC where kikuyu has invaded the pastures in coastal regions, causing osteoporosis and Big Head in horses even when owners don’t suspect it could be a problem
*In spring and summer (or for fertilised pastures), when grass growth is rapid and tropical grasses contain higher levels of oxalates
*Horses consuming predominately Teff hay or pangola hay which may contain high levels of oxalate chemicals
*For bone mineral needs in horses with high phytate dietary sources (including bran and certain grains)
*For horses with extra bone mineral needs, including those in regular work and with low lucerne diets.
*For horses suffering from bone demineralisation or Big Head.
